    It is an interference engine. Replace the belt now, and also replace any and all camshaft or crankshaft seals even if not now leaking. They probably are brittle, will leak and the oil will cause deterioration and weakening of the new (or existing) timing belt. Above from very recent January, 2002 EXPERIENCE. The seals are cheap, finding them?? Maybe the people having the timing belt will have the seals.
